Sorts Of Customized Lenses



When considering custom lens substitute surgery, it is necessary to comprehend the various types of custom-made lenses offered to meet your certain vision needs.



There are 3 primary types of custom-made lenses: monofocal, multifocal, and toric lenses.

Monofocal lenses are made to deal with vision for one range, either near or far.

If you have presbyopia, a problem that affects your capability to focus on close things, multifocal lenses might be the best option for you. These lenses have various zones for near, intermediate, and range vision.

Toric lenses, on the other hand, are specifically created for people with astigmatism. They remedy both astigmatism and nearsightedness or farsightedness.

Understanding the various types of custom-made lenses will assist you make an enlightened decision regarding which option is ideal suited for your vision requires.

Dangers and Benefits



Now let's discover the prospective threats and advantages related to custom-made lens replacement surgical treatment. Lasik HSA provides many advantages, however it is very important to be familiar with the potential risks also. Here are the key things you need to recognize:

Advantages:
- Enhanced vision: Personalized lens substitute surgery can substantially enhance your vision, enabling you to see even more clearly and vividly.
- Decreased dependence on glasses or contact lenses: With customized lenses, many clients experience reduced dependence on restorative glasses.
- Long-lasting outcomes: The results of custom lens substitute surgery are commonly permanent, giving long-lasting visual renovation.

Dangers:
- Infection: Just like any surgery, there's a small risk of infection, although this is uncommon.
- Glow or halos: Some individuals may experience momentary visual disruptions, such as glow or halos around lights, which typically decrease in time.
- Retinal detachment: Although incredibly uncommon, there's a slight danger of retinal detachment following customized lens replacement surgical procedure.

It is essential to talk about these threats and benefits with your eye doctor to determine if custom-made lens replacement surgery is the ideal choice for you.

Preparing for Surgical treatment



To prepare for custom lens replacement surgical treatment, you should follow your ophthalmologist's directions and make necessary setups. Your ophthalmologist will supply you with details guidelines to ensure a smooth and effective surgical procedure. It is very important to carefully follow these guidelines to decrease any potential threats and complications.

This may consist of staying clear of particular drugs or dietary supplements that might interfere with the surgery, along with stopping using call lenses prior to the treatment. Additionally, you may be needed to undergo pre-operative screening to evaluate your eye wellness and figure out the suitable lens replacement alternatives for your demands.

It's likewise vital to make necessary arrangements for transportation to and from the surgical center, as you might not be able to drive immediately after the treatment.
